huh (oh)



[Date: 1600-1700; Origin: A natural sound]
used to show that you have not heard or understood a question
¡¡'Carly, are you listening to me?' 'Huh?'
especially AmE used at the end of a question, often to ask for agreement
¡¡Not a bad little place, huh?
used to show disagreement or surprise, or to show that you do not find something impressive
¡¡'She looks nice.' 'Huh! Too much make-up, if you ask me.'
